测试并验证默认选中功能是否按预期工作: 运行你的Vue应用,查看 el-checkbox-group 组件中的 el-checkbox 是否按照预期默认选中了指定的选项。 你可以通过修改 checkedCities 数组的内容来测试不同的默认选中项。 综上所述,通过正确设置 v-model 绑定的数组,你可以轻松实现 el-checkbox-group 的默认选中功能。
</el-checkbox-group> 备注:v-model 直接绑定value的似乎不需要这样直接可以绑定,我这种是绑定的Object,所以需要这样写 这种情况设置默认值 本来只需要设置: this.form.showProperty = ['a','b'] 我们页面就可以默认选中a选项和b选项,实际上当我们这样写的时候却不能实现默认选中,我们只需将设置选中代码写入$ne...
</el-checkbox-group> function checkOnlyOnBox(event: any){if("el-checkbox__inner"!=event.target.className){ //点击的不是前面的小框框,阻止默认行为 event.preventDefault(); }else{//点击的是前面的小框框} }
我想做的选项默认不勾选,等待用户勾选后才有值。 <el-form-item label="一、单选题:"> 题目:{{item.question}} <el-checkbox-group v-model="item.userAnswer" @change="handleCheckedSingleChoiceAnswerChange"> <el-checkbox v-for="answer in item.answerList" :label="answer" :key="answer">{{...
最后建议不要用这个方法, 因为你必须保证选中的对象和默认列表的对象完全一致,才会勾选上,看你的数据你会有fiterTypeByOne\checked这两个属性不知道会不会变化, 如果发生变化, 你就无法默认选中了我自己遇到这种情况是只用el-checkbox循环不用el-checkbox-group ...
checkbox-group元素能把多个 checkbox 管理为一组,只需要在 Group 中使用v-model绑定Array类型的变量即可。 el-checkbox 的 label属性是该 checkbox 对应的值,若该标签中无内容,则该属性也充当 checkbox 按钮后的介绍。 label与数组中的元素值相对应,如果存在指定的值则为选中状态,否则为不选中。
vueelement的 el-checkbox-group默认全部选中 1 <!--标注选择标签弹层组件--> 2 <template> 3 4 5 6 <el-checkbox :indeterminate="isIndeterminate" v-model="checkAll" @change="handleCheckAllChange">全选 7 </el-checkbox> 8 9 10 <el-checkbox-group v-model="checkedCities" @change="handl...
e只是单纯的true值。我是看jsx的文档中说不支持v-model,需要按照这样的写法来获取的。 但是如果在el-checkbox-group 这里直接写v-model={this.checkList} 同样没有效果。 v-model绑定group,checkbox里绑定label值这样的数组渲染可否提供下demo呢,谢谢 constdata=['选项1','选项2','选项3'];constcheckboxes=data...
checkboxRenderer:function(value, cellmeta, record,rowIndex, columnIndex, store){ var row = this.grid.getStore().getById(record.id); var id = row.get(this.id_key); //this.id_key 是一行的key 这样,可以根据这一行资料确定是否需要默认选择或根本就不出现选择框。